Cycle disruption after childbirth

Restoring normal periods for each mother is individual. In a woman who has given birth, a violation of up to 6 months is accepted as the norm. Typically, for non-breastfeeding mothers, it takes 8 weeks postpartum for the menstrual cycle to return. For women who are breastfeeding, their period may not come until six months or the end of lactation. Their absence is due to the predominance of some hormones over others. For example, prolactin, which is responsible for the formation of milk, suppresses the appearance and release of eggs in the menstrual cycle.

After childbirth

There are several factors that make a woman's menstrual cycle irregular after childbirth:

  • Mother's weight. Women tend to gain weight during pregnancy, which doesn't go away until several months after giving birth. Some people lose weight due to lack of proper nutrition and sleep. In both cases, weight directly affects changes in hormonal levels in the body, which leads to irregular menstrual cycles.
  • Breast-feeding. Mothers who breastfeed their babies tend to ovulate later after giving birth. The hormone responsible for the secretion of milk from the glands (prolactin) affects the lack of ovulation. This is why your period comes later than usual.
  • Changed hormone levels. During pregnancy, a mother's body begins to change levels of hormones that prepare her for childbirth, childbirth and breastfeeding. They do not immediately return to normal after childbirth. This causes menstrual cycles to become erratic and unpredictable for several months until the hormones calm down.

Cyclodinone

A popular herbal medicine that can normalize the level of female sex hormones is Cyclodinone. The main pharmacological effect is associated with a decrease in prolactin production. It is reliably known that if there is a high level of prolactin, this affects the secretion of gonadotropic hormones, leading to an imbalance between progesterone and estrogen. This results in disruptions in the menstrual cycle and the appearance of painful sensations in the mammary glands (mastodynia), requiring adequate treatment.

By reducing the concentration of prolactin, Cyclodinone helps not only normalize menstruation, but also eliminate the pathological process in the mammary gland and relieve pain. In addition, the production of gonadotropic hormones is established. Based on the above, we can conclude that the main indications for the use of Cyclodinone will be:

  • Menstrual disorder.
  • Severe premenstrual syndrome.
  • Painful sensations in the chest (mastodynia).

The only contraindications that should be noted are hypersensitivity to the components of the drug. Undesirable side effects are extremely rare. Isolated cases of the development of an allergic reaction (skin rashes, urticaria, itching, etc.), emotional agitation, confusion and hallucinatory states have been recorded. The duration of the therapeutic course is usually about 80–90 days. However, even after the cessation of clinical symptoms, it is recommended to continue treatment for several more weeks.

A healthy woman of fertile age should have menstruation every month, with the exception of the period of pregnancy and some time (on average 6 months) after childbirth, if the woman is breastfeeding.

The normal functioning of the female reproductive system is considered to be:

  • presence of a regular menstrual cycle lasting from 21 to 34 days;
  • duration of bleeding from 3 to 7 days;
  • moderate amounts of discharge;
  • absence of severe or sharp pain, nausea and dizziness during menstruation.

If significant deviations are observed according to at least one of the listed criteria, we can talk about the presence of disruptions in the course of the female monthly cycle.

Let us clarify that the duration of the cycle is the number of days from the 1st day of one menstruation to the 1st day of the next, not including this day.

In the case of normal functioning of the female genital organs, the duration of the cycle for a particular woman has a certain stable value, ideally it is 28 days, which corresponds to the duration of the lunar month.

According to many gynecologists, a deviation in the duration of the cycle by a maximum of 5 days in one direction or another is acceptable, unless, of course, this is systematic and is associated with some external factors, such as a change climate zone, transfer colds, experienced a stressful situation, etc.

Fgo_e1vd-EE

If the duration of the cycle constantly “walks” in one direction or the other for more than 5 days, this is a reason to consult a doctor to find out the reasons.

If the cycle is more or less regular, but suddenly there is a delay, then a delay of more than a week can be considered a deviation.

The duration of monthly bleeding is individual for each woman, and normally it lasts the same number of days each month. However, for the same woman at different periods of life, this duration tends to change. Thus, young girls are characterized by a longer period of bleeding, which tends to decrease with age.

Regarding the amount of discharge: as a rule, in the first 3 days of the cycle this amount is maximum and gradually decreases towards the end of menstruation. Normally, up to 50 ml of blood is lost over the entire period of menstruation, this does not take into account the volume of mucous secretions and the remnants of exfoliated endometrium, which make up the bulk of the secretions. The intensity of the discharge is individual for each woman, but during the normal course of the process, even in the first days of menstruation, it is such that one sanitary pad should be enough for 3-4 hours.

If the discharge is too abundant or, conversely, too scanty, then this is a signal of the presence of any disturbances in the functioning of the genital organs.

Regarding how you feel during your period: on the first day of your menstrual cycle, it is acceptable to feel heaviness and nagging pain in the lower abdomen or lower back. However, if the pain is strong and sharp, accompanied by severe dizziness and nausea, then this may be the cause of any disorders or diseases.
